Reg Hawkins, Multicultural Student Services, authored the article "From Trauma-Informed to Healing-Centered: Advancing Institutional Accountability and Black Student Belonging in Higher Education" in The Vermont Connection,  accepted for publication by University of Vermont. This article explores the limits of trauma-informed practices for Black students in higher education. Drawing on racial trauma scholarship and healing-centered engagement, the piece offers a framework for institutional change, community care and Black student belonging.
